Understanding the Mechanics of the Ascent
At its heart, the ‘aviator’ game operates on a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This means that the outcome of each round isn't predetermined, but rather is determined by a complex algorithm ensuring transparency and fairness. Players watch a virtual aircraft take off, and as it gains altitude, a multiplier increases correspondingly. This multiplier represents the potential profit on their initial bet. The crucial aspect – and the source of the game’s tension – is that the flight can end at any moment. The plane can ‘crash’ at 1.0x, 2.0x, or ascend to much higher multipliers, even exceeding 100x or more.
The RNG determines the exact point at which the plane will cease its ascent. Players must anticipate this point and manually ‘cash out’ their bet before the crash. If they successfully cash out before the plane disappears, they receive their initial stake multiplied by the current multiplier. If the plane crashes before they cash out, they lose their wager. The Importance of Auto Cash-Out Features
Many aviator platforms incorporate an auto cash-out feature. This allows players to pre-set a desired multiplier, and the game will automatically cash out their bet when that multiplier is reached. This feature is incredibly useful for mitigating risk and ensuring consistent profits. It removes the need for players to constantly monitor the screen and react quickly, which can be particularly helpful in fast-paced gaming environments. However, it's important to configure the auto cash-out feature carefully, considering one’s risk tolerance and betting strategy.
